10 Must-Ask Questions for Fort Collins Foundation Repair Contractors

1

Are you licensed in Colorado?

Ask for the license number — then verify it online. Colorado requires specific licensing for foundation repair work. An unlicensed contractor might be cheaper, but you have zero protection if something goes wrong.

2

Do you carry liability insurance AND workers' comp?

Get a certificate of insurance emailed directly from their agent. If a worker gets injured on your property and the contractor has no workers' comp, you could be liable. Minimum coverage should be $500K liability.

3

Can I see 3 recent Fort Collins references?

Ask for references from projects completed in the last 12 months — and actually call them. Ask: Was the work completed on time? On budget? Any surprises? Would you hire them again? Drive by completed projects if possible.

4

How many foundation repair projects have you completed in Fort Collins?

Local experience matters. A contractor who's done 100 projects in Fort Collins knows our building department, common issues with Fort Collins homes, and which materials hold up here. A contractor from outside the area may not.

5

What's included in your quote — exactly?

A real quote is detailed. Materials (brands, grades, quantities), labor breakdown, permits, site prep, debris removal, cleanup, warranty terms — everything. If it's not in writing, assume it's not included. Verbal promises are worth the paper they're written on.

6

What's your payment schedule?

Industry standard: 10-30% deposit at signing, progress payments tied to milestones, 10-20% final payment after walkthrough. Never pay 100% upfront. Never pay in cash without a receipt. If a contractor demands >50% upfront, that's a red flag.

7

What's the project timeline?

Get start date, estimated completion date, daily work hours, and what happens if there are weather delays. Fort Collins's weather can impact schedules — a good contractor builds buffer days into their timeline.

8

Who handles permits — and are they included?

Fort Collins and Larimer County may require permits for your foundation repair project. Permits protect you — they ensure the work meets code. A reputable contractor handles permits and includes them in the quote. If they suggest skipping permits, walk away.

9

What warranty do you offer?

Two types: workmanship warranty (the contractor's labor) and material warranty (the manufacturer). Get both in writing. Standard workmanship warranty is 1-5 years. Premium materials often come with 15-25 year manufacturer warranties. Know what's covered — and what voids the warranty.

10

Who will be on-site daily?

Is it the owner? A foreman? Subcontractors? If subs are used, are they also licensed and insured? You want to know who's in your home, and you want a single point of contact for questions and updates.

Red Flags to Watch For

🚩

No license or insurance proof

If they can't produce a Colorado license number and insurance certificate within 24 hours, move on.

🚩

Full payment upfront

Anyone asking for 100% payment before starting work is either desperate or dishonest. Standard deposit is 10-30%.

🚩

No written contract

Always get a detailed written contract. Verbal agreements are unenforceable and lead to disputes.

🚩

Price too good to be true

If one Fort Collins quote is 40%+ lower than others, something is being cut — materials, labor quality, permits, or insurance.
